Description
I just tested the update in pre-production for 2.1_release
The configuration is CARP and BGP with 2 machines.
Unfortunately the slave makes a crash with this error message pfr_unroute_kentry: delete failed.
Unreachable slave. I tried both ways each time the slave makes a crash after a few minutes. Whether one to the other machines.
To be safe I turned off the Synchronize States and Configuration Synchronization Settings
The solution on thoses box was stable in all version from 1.2.x to 2.0.x
do you have any idéas ?.
sorry Affected Architecture: i386

Sorry i forget this story. But yes I have very very big tables in my setup where i have this trouble.
But i had some trouble with network hardware in same time. When i solved the hardware trouble i see juste two time it in 3 month.
2.1.1-RELEASE (amd64) built on Tue Apr 1 15:22:32 EDT 2014 FreeBSD 8.3-RELEASE-p14 on new hp server 360 G6
Intel(R) Xeon(R) CPU E5-2407 v2 @ 2.40GHz 4 CPUs: 1 package(s) x 4 core(s)
I see this trouble back . And yes i have some alias and i use pfblocker with some big table. And opengbp
hi all,
for follow this trouble, i erase all my pfblocker's tables and i just keep two very importantes. Today it s very stable. So thank you to Ermal Luçi about this idéa. I think this trouble is in freebsd not in pfsense. I have some firewall with a lot of table but without carp are stable.
